Had a great time when Grammy, Pampy and Auntie came to visit. Did very well and enjoyed having new people in the house. Keeps looking all over for them now that they are gone.

Last week, Kal started eating poop- his own, the girls'... all of it- and I keep the yard pretty picked up, believe it or not. He literally will follow behind them and scoop it up as they're dropping it, or go out first thing in the morning and eat whatever he pooped out during his nighttime potty breaks (still having at least one of those each night) instead of doing his business. He's getting better at leaving it alone when told, though the first time he just stared right at me and kept on going.

I started giving him a pre-biotic last week, just in case the round of antibiotics he was on last month destroyed his gut flora. This week, I'm reducing it to every other day. Once it's gone, I won't continue. Seems to be helping with the diarrhea issues of two weeks ago, though it might also be the cause of the sudden interest in poop- especially since Kansas has taken an interest in his, and is also part of the problem.

Also, after luring him into the bathtub with a treat during his bath last week, instead of just picking him up, he's now decided getting in/out of the bathtub is a fun trick and climbs into the tub to go exploring pretty regularly. He's always been fascinated with the bathtub and routinely sticks his head behind the shower curtain to investigate, and then slides all the way behind the curtain to play around, but this takes things to a whole new level.

He is easily entertained, at least.
